Three more suspensions over Neelagiri’s death
January 22, 2011 02:04 pm
Another three individuals have been suspended in connection to the death of the 23-year-old elephant at the Pinnawela orphanage, Director of the Zoological Department Baashwara Gunaratne stated.
He said that the suspended were a female official and two mahouts and that the decision had bee taken in relation to the investigation that’s being carried out on the death of the male pachyderm.
Thereby the chief officer in charge of the Wagolla and Pinnawela Zoo and Elephant Orphanage, who was transferred immediately following the incident, has now been suspended according to the reports received from the investigation.
If they are found not guilty at the conclusion of the investigations then the penalty would be eased. However if they are found guilty then the sentences would continue to be in affect, Mr. Gunaratne pointed out.
With this six workers at the Pinnawela Elephant Orphanage have presently been suspended in regard to the death of the elephant ‘Neelagiri’.
